BIRS Commences Training, Retraining of Staff For Effective Service Delivery

By Isaac Kertyo, Makurdi

Determined to improve the revenue profile of the state, the Acting Executive Chairman, Benue Internal Revenue Service, BIRS, Mr Emmanuel Agema, has sent 22 staff for a 3-day workshop North Central Regional training for tax investigation, audit, compliance and enforcement, organised by Nasarawa Government in collaboration with Joint Tax Board, JTB.

A statement by the Media Assistant to the Chairman, Jacinta Bernard, recalled that the service under Mr Agema, organized first annual staff retreat in the Makurdi, the Benue State capital to improve the knowledge and skills of the staff.

According to the statement, the Tax Boss is maximizing revenue generation through the utilization of skilled and professional staff via training and retraining of personnel towards effective service delivery. “It is important to note that, there have been periodic in-house training at the tax house” to enable them acquire skills to ensure maximum results.

“The Chairman’s commitment to training his staff stems from his astute leadership style, flare for professionalism”, stressing that this has positively yielded positive results since assumption of office.
